Position Overview

The Material Handler will pick orders/materials, unload trailers, sort, and label raw materials, put away product to pick locations, move materials to/from production areas, palletize /shrink wrap pallets, scan information using RF, load pallets onto trucks. Use of manual or electric pallet jacks, forklift, order picker, hoist, and/or turret truck will be required depending on area working.

Responsibilities
  • Load/Unload trucks
  • Accurately pick orders for customers or materials for production and complete required paperwork
  • Lift and move items weighing up to 50lbs-100lbs on a regular basis for up to 12 hours.
  • Place completed orders into storage racking maintaining accurate placement.
  • Maintain and keep clean a safe work environment.
  • Understand the different product/material in respected area.
  • Assist in the inventory process.
  • Operate machinery/equipment in a safe and controlled manner.
  • Accurately use RF equipment for order and material recording.
